Sylvaner Wine
Sylvaner (also known as Silvaner) is a white wine grape variety, mainly grown across Germany and in the Alsace region in France. This grape is known for its distinctively full-bodied style with aromas of earth and smoke, with fruity flavours. In our option it pairs best with pork and game, and served at around 5ºC.
